  • Publication number: 20110246967
    Abstract: A system and methods for providing an extensible automation framework for testing computer software are provided. Features include a framework application, a framework engine with multiple organizational levels, a subsumption engine, library modules, and global environment data. Functionality is subsumed directly from library modules into class objects allowing users to integrate new functionality directly into the automation framework without the need to create new classes. A subsumption engine extends a software language's native reference resolution mechanism with the ability to resolve references to static functions, static data, and other software entities as references to objects in the multiple organizational levels, both in the application module and in library modules.
